Hi there. I certainly recommend that book if you're interested in the area. Sex and gender studies are fascinating areas, but the battle I highlight in my journal entry (the two positions: does nature matter somewhat, or not at all?) mark out some fairly fraught battle lines. Lots of gender theorists still argue the notion that ALL we are as genders is given to us by society and cultural forces. The book I'm talking about is one of a number trying to bring nature, biology, and evolution back into the picture.
